@mammastenhjerte
@mammastenhjerte 4 жыл бұрын
I think it was a time issue. P3 Live is a radio show and the artists do an interview and get to sing one of their own song and do a cover, but they do not know in advance what song they will be covering and only get to know that less than an hour before they go on live. In that time the artist has to make an arrangement, memories the lyric as much as possible and rehearse a couple of time, and then they go on live. Aurora has covered Wrecking Ball, Believer, God Is A Woman and Det Hev Ei Rose Sprunge (a German Christmas song form 1599 sung in Norwegian) on P3 Live, and you can see she has notes in front of her with the lyrics.

@danielpurpletree8440
@danielpurpletree8440 4 жыл бұрын
Silja Sol is Aurora backup singer & is an artist in her own right & has released her own albums. Her voice is quite different sounding to Aurora's but very beautiful on its own & when paired with Aurora's can produce beautiful harmonies. The rest of her band are awesome too there's been a couple of different members other the years but they've all been great.
